The Number opposites exercise appears under the 6th grade (U.S.) Math Mission, Arithmetic essentials Math Mission, Pre-algebra Math Mission and Mathematics I Math Mission. This exercise helps understanding of the similarities and differences between the concept of opposite and the negative sign.

Types of Problems[]

There are two types of problems in this exercise:

  1. Determine the correct point: The problem asks which of the labeled points on a number line is the solution to a question about opposites. The user is expected to find the correct point and select it from a multiple choice list.

  2. Find the opposite: This problem asks the users determine the opposite of a particular number. In this problem the user is asked to write the answer in a provided answer box.

Strategies[]

This problem is easy to get accuracy badges because opposites have many different representations but all take one step to find. The speed badges are also easy because to solve the problems in the exercise is rarely more than one step of reasoning.

  1. Be a little careful to distinguish whether the problem is asking for the opposite of the number given, or if it is asking to evaluate an expression with a negative sign.

Real-life Applications[]

  1. Negative numbers are used to represent land below sea level.
  2. Negative numbers are used to describe values on a scale that goes below zero, such as the Celsius and Fahrenheit scales for temperature.
